Decoding the Manufacturing Excellence of H05V-K Wires

Precision Manufacturing Process for Optimal Performance

The production of a high-quality oem h05v k cable involves a series of meticulously controlled stages designed to ensure consistent performance, durability, and safety. Starting with high-purity electrolytic copper, the process begins with rod breakdown and multi-wire drawing, where copper rods are stretched through a series of dies to achieve the desired conductor cross-sectional area and flexibility. This mechanical process is critical for producing the fine strands that define the H05V-K's flexibility, a key advantage in complex wiring applications. Following drawing, an annealing process softens the copper, enhancing its flexibility and electrical conductivity by reducing internal stresses from drawing.

Next, the stranded conductor assembly is fed into an extrusion line where a layer of high-grade Polyvinyl Chloride (PVC) compound is precisely applied to form the insulation. This PVC compound is specially formulated for electrical applications, offering excellent dielectric strength, heat resistance up to 70°C, and flame retardant properties. Continuous monitoring during extrusion ensures uniform insulation thickness, vital for electrical integrity and long-term reliability. Post-extrusion, the insulated wire undergoes rigorous spark testing to detect any microscopic flaws or pinholes in the insulation, preventing potential electrical breakdowns. Final quality checks involve dimensional measurements, electrical resistance tests, and mechanical strength tests to confirm compliance with international standards such as IEC 60227, VDE 0281, and HAR harmonization, ensuring that every oem h05v k product meets the highest benchmarks for safety and performance before packaging and dispatch. This rigorous control throughout the manufacturing lifecycle underpins the product's superior service life, often exceeding 25 years under specified operating conditions.

Technical Specifications and Performance Metrics

Understanding the technical parameters of oem h05v k cables is fundamental for selecting the correct wire for specific applications. These parameters directly influence the cable's performance, safety, and longevity. Key specifications include the nominal cross-sectional area of the conductor, which dictates its current-carrying capacity, and the insulation thickness, which determines its dielectric strength and voltage rating. The H05V-K is rated for 300/500V, meaning it can handle up to 300V phase-to-earth and 500V phase-to-phase, making it suitable for a wide range of low-voltage electrical circuits. The conductor is typically Class 5 stranded copper, known for its high flexibility, which is crucial for internal wiring and connections within confined spaces.

Our offerings, including oem h05v k 0.75 and oem h05v k 1mm2, adhere strictly to IEC 60227-3 (formerly VDE 0281-3) standards, ensuring universal compatibility and reliability. The operating temperature range is a critical factor; for H05V-K, it is typically -5°C to +70°C for fixed installation, allowing for stable performance in typical indoor environments. Short-circuit temperature limits are also specified, providing a safety margin under fault conditions. The table below presents typical technical parameters for common H05V-K sizes, offering a quick reference for engineers and buyers considering to buy h05v k for their projects.

Typical H05V-K Technical Specifications

Parameter 0.75 mm² (H05V-K) 1.0 mm² (H05V-K) 1.5 mm² (H05V-K)
Nominal Cross-Section 0.75 mm² 1.0 mm² 1.5 mm²
Conductor Type Class 5 Stranded Copper Class 5 Stranded Copper Class 5 Stranded Copper
Voltage Rating (U0/U) 300/500 V 300/500 V 300/500 V
Max. Conductor Temp. (Fixed) 70°C 70°C 70°C
Approx. Outer Diameter 2.6 mm 2.8 mm 3.1 mm
Max. Conductor Resistance at 20°C 26.0 Ω/km 19.5 Ω/km 13.3 Ω/km
Approx. Weight 11.0 kg/km 14.0 kg/km 19.0 kg/km
Short Circuit Temp. (Max. 5s) 160°C 160°C 160°C

  • Q: What makes H05V-K different from other PVC insulated wires?

    A: The H05V-K specifically refers to a harmonized flexible PVC insulated single-core cable designed for internal wiring. Its key distinction lies in its Class 5 flexible copper conductor and adherence to strict European harmonization standards (HAR), ensuring its suitability and safety for fixed installations in electrical apparatus and switchgear at 300/500V. This standardization simplifies international procurement and compliance.
